Step 1: Unbox and Inspect Your Noise Smart Watch

Before you power on your device, take a moment to unbox it carefully. Most Noise smart watches come with the following items:

  • The smart watch itself
  • Magnetic charging cable
  • User manual and warranty card
  • Quick start guide (sometimes)

Check that all components are present and undamaged. If anything is missing or looks broken, contact Noise customer support immediately.

Charge Your Watch Before First Use

Even if your watch shows some battery, it’s best to charge it fully before setup. Here’s how:

  1. Connect the magnetic charging cable to the back of your watch. The pins should align automatically.
  2. Plug the USB end into a power adapter or computer USB port.
  3. Wait until the battery icon shows 100%. This usually takes 1–2 hours.

Pro Tip: Avoid using third-party chargers, as they may damage the battery or cause slow charging. Stick to the included cable or a certified replacement.

Step 2: Download and Install the NoiseFit App

The NoiseFit app is the heart of your smart watch experience. It’s available for both Android and iOS devices and is essential for syncing data, updating firmware, and customizing settings.

How to Download the App

  1. Open the Google Play Store (Android) or App Store (iOS) on your smartphone.
  2. Search for “NoiseFit” – make sure it’s the official app by Noise (check the developer name).
  3. Tap “Install” and wait for the download to complete.
  4. Open the app once installed.

Note: The app is free and regularly updated. Keep it updated to ensure compatibility with your watch model.

Create or Log In to Your Account

When you open the NoiseFit app for the first time:

  • If you’re new, tap “Sign Up” and enter your email, create a password, and verify your account.
  • If you already have an account, tap “Log In” and enter your credentials.

Having an account allows you to back up your health data, sync across devices, and receive personalized insights.

Step 3: Enable Bluetooth and Location Services

To pair your Noise smart watch with your phone, you’ll need to enable two key settings: Bluetooth and location services.

Enable Bluetooth

  1. Go to your phone’s Settings.
  2. Tap “Bluetooth” and toggle it on.
  3. Make sure your phone is discoverable (this happens automatically when Bluetooth is on).

Enable Location Services (Important!)

Many users skip this step, but it’s crucial for pairing. Here’s why:

  • Android and iOS use location services to detect nearby Bluetooth devices.
  • Without it, the NoiseFit app may not find your watch.

To enable location:

  1. Go to Settings > Privacy & Security (iOS) or Settings > Location (Android).
  2. Turn on Location Services.
  3. Allow the NoiseFit app to access your location (select “While Using the App” or “Always”).

Tip: On Android, you may also need to enable “Nearby Device Scanning” in Bluetooth settings for better detection.

Step 4: Power On and Pair Your Noise Smart Watch

Now it’s time to wake up your watch and connect it to your phone.

Turn On Your Watch

  1. Press and hold the side button (or touch the screen if it’s a touch model) for 3–5 seconds.
  2. The Noise logo should appear, followed by the home screen or a pairing prompt.

If your watch doesn’t turn on, ensure it’s fully charged. Some models require a long press to activate for the first time.

Start Pairing via the NoiseFit App

  1. Open the NoiseFit app on your phone.
  2. Tap the “+” or “Add Device” button (usually in the top-right corner).
  3. The app will scan for nearby devices. Wait a few seconds—your watch should appear in the list.
  4. Tap on your watch model (e.g., Noise ColorFit Pro 4, Noise Fit Voyage, etc.).
  5. Confirm the pairing request on both your phone and watch screen.

Note: If your watch doesn’t appear, try moving closer to your phone, restarting Bluetooth, or restarting both devices.

Complete the Setup Wizard

Once paired, the app will guide you through a quick setup:

  • Select your preferred language.
  • Set your time zone and date format.
  • Choose whether to enable notifications, health tracking, and Do Not Disturb mode.
  • Sync your watch with your phone’s calendar (optional).

Follow the on-screen prompts to finish the setup. Your watch will now sync data with the app.

Step 5: Customize Your Noise Smart Watch

Now that your watch is connected, it’s time to make it truly yours.

Change the Watch Face

Noise smart watches offer a variety of watch faces—digital, analog, minimalist, sporty, and more.

  1. Open the NoiseFit app.
  2. Tap “Watch Faces” or “My Watch” > “Watch Face”.
  3. Browse the gallery and tap on a design you like.
  4. Tap “Apply” to send it to your watch.

Some models allow you to upload custom photos as watch faces. Look for the “Custom” or “Photo” option in the app.

Set Up Notifications

Stay connected without pulling out your phone. Here’s how to manage notifications:

  1. In the NoiseFit app, go to “Notifications” or “App Alerts”.
  2. Toggle on the apps you want to receive notifications from (e.g., WhatsApp, SMS, Gmail, Instagram).
  3. Choose whether to show message previews or just app icons.
  4. Enable “Do Not Disturb” during sleep or meetings if needed.

Tip: Too many notifications can drain your battery. Only enable alerts for essential apps.

Adjust Display and Sound Settings

Customize how your watch looks and sounds:

  • Brightness: Go to Settings > Display > Brightness. Adjust for indoor or outdoor use.
  • Screen Timeout: Set how long the screen stays on after a tap (e.g., 5–15 seconds).
  • Vibration: Toggle vibration for calls, messages, and alarms.
  • Sound: Some models support ringtones for calls—enable in Settings > Sound.

Step 6: Set Up Health and Fitness Tracking

One of the biggest advantages of a Noise smart watch is its health monitoring features. Let’s configure them.

Enable Heart Rate Monitoring

  1. Open the NoiseFit app.
  2. Go to “Health” or “Heart Rate”.
  3. Toggle on “Auto Heart Rate Monitoring”.
  4. Set the frequency (e.g., every 10 minutes, 30 minutes, or continuous during workouts).

Note: Continuous monitoring uses more battery. Choose a balance that fits your needs.

Set Up Sleep Tracking

  1. In the app, go to “Sleep” or “Health” > “Sleep”.
  2. Enable “Auto Sleep Tracking”.
  3. Set your usual sleep and wake times for better accuracy.

Your watch will automatically detect when you fall asleep and wake up, providing insights into sleep duration and quality.

Configure Workout Modes

Noise watches support multiple sports modes (running, cycling, yoga, swimming, etc.).

  1. In the app, go to “Workout” or “Exercise”.
  2. Select your favorite activities and add them to your quick-access list.
  3. Set goals (e.g., 30 minutes of walking, 5,000 steps).

During a workout, swipe to the exercise mode on your watch, select your activity, and tap “Start”.

Track Steps and Calories

These features are usually enabled by default, but you can customize goals:

  • Go to “Activity” or “Steps” in the app.
  • Set a daily step goal (e.g., 8,000 or 10,000 steps).
  • View calorie burn estimates based on your activity level.

Step 7: Sync Data and Update Firmware

Keeping your watch updated ensures optimal performance and access to new features.

Sync Your Data

Your watch automatically syncs with the app when in range, but you can force a sync:

  1. Open the NoiseFit app.
  2. Pull down on the home screen or tap the sync icon.
  3. Wait for the sync to complete (usually takes 10–30 seconds).

Tip: Sync daily to back up your health data and free up watch storage.

Check for Firmware Updates

  1. In the app, go to “My Watch” or “Device”.
  2. Tap “Firmware Update” or “Check for Updates”.
  3. If an update is available, tap “Download and Install”.
  4. Keep your watch charged and near your phone during the update.

Updates may take 5–10 minutes and will restart your watch. Don’t disconnect during this process.

Step 8: Troubleshooting Common Issues

Even with careful setup, you might run into problems. Here’s how to fix the most common ones.

Watch Won’t Pair with Phone

  • Ensure Bluetooth and location are enabled.
  • Restart both your phone and watch.
  • Forget the device in your phone’s Bluetooth settings and try pairing again.
  • Make sure the NoiseFit app has all required permissions.

Notifications Not Coming Through

  • Check that the app is allowed to send notifications in your phone’s settings.
  • Ensure “Do Not Disturb” is off on both your phone and watch.
  • Re-pair the watch if the issue persists.

Battery Drains Too Fast

  • Reduce screen brightness and timeout duration.
  • Disable unnecessary notifications and health tracking features.
  • Turn off always-on display if your model supports it.
  • Update to the latest firmware—battery optimizations are often included.

Watch Freezes or Lags

  • Restart your watch by holding the side button for 10–15 seconds.
  • Clear the app cache in your phone’s settings.
  • Reset the watch to factory settings (last resort—back up data first).
